We've crunched the numbers, reviewed them, counted the restaurants and museums, reviewed MCAS data, and looked at housing and crime statistics, and we're ready to reveal the Top Ten Communities in Massachusetts.  

This is a tough list to get on - only a few communities cracked the top ten for more than one metric; some never made the top ten for any individual metric, but instead made the Top Ten Best Communities list through a combination of its metrics.

Some of these are to be expected: Boston and Cambridge, which are known for their thriving arts communities, educational institutions and numerous and varied restaurants.  Other communities made the list through a combination of their safe environment, excellent schools and cultural offerings.  

Worcester, the #1 community in Central Mass also makes the list.   Did other communities from Central Mass make it?
